Me, myself, and I

A Poem by Prudence Desideria
"

Who we are in the moments of time... Everchanging, fading and reaching all at once.

"

 

Eyes open

Watching

Asking

Gently

Softly

 

Come with me…

 

Hold my hand…

 

Hearing

The world

Shouts

Stop

Silence

 

Curl up beside me

 

Love me gently

 

The past

Lingers

Stings

Havoc

Calm

 

Perfectly imperfect…

 

Move slow, just stop for a moment…

 

Future

Uncertain

Strong

Somewhere

 

Never buy me flowers

 

Know me

 

Me, myself, and I

Tired

Desperate

Calm

hopeful
